incommensurable

adj
  • Not able to be measured by the same standards as another term in the context. 

  • having a ratio that is not expressible as a fraction of two integers. 

  • having no common integer divisor except 1. 

noun
  • An incommensurable value or quantity; an irrational number. 

nonidentical

adj
  • Not identical; different in some respect. 

noun
  • A twin other than an identical twin.
